

Fifty-Nine Stepinac High School Students Inducted into National Honor Society
The NHS was created to recognize the nation's outstanding high school students. Each year, students are inducted into Stepinac’s chapter based on their high academic performance, their service to the school and community, their demonstrated leadership skills and their good character.
Fifty-nine Stepinac High School students were inducted into the National Honor Society (NHS) during a ceremony held at the school.
Fr. Thomas Collins (Class of ’79), President, officiated and congratulated each student at the annual event which was also attended by parents and other family members and members of the administration and faculty of the renowned all-boys Catholic high school.
